WebScintillators can be made in different sizes, and the thickness of the scintillator determines its ability to absorb and detect certain radiation emissions. A thin scintillator is an excellent choice for low-energy gamma rays and high-energy beta particles. Most machines also contain reference detectors that are ... WebJun 14, 2024 · The first detector prototype was very simple. I filled a small PVC pipe with liquid scintillator and inserted some circuitry and a silicon photomultiplier. Two wires penetrated the PVC cap: one for biasing the photomultiplier and one for outputting data to an oscilloscope. It was not a great design.
